Hi I'm an eea citizen and I want to apply for my non eea motherinlaw's eea2 resident card. At the moment she holds a 2 years visitor visa and she is here for last 3 months.
I want her to settle here with us as there is no one in her country to look after her and she is getting old now . She is 63 years.

Can u plz guide me.

1. Is she eligible for eea RC?

2. What documents do I need to send to HO?

Thanks

Posted: Sat Jan 15, 2011 5:37 pm
by 86ti
1. Yes, if she is dependent on you. See Chapter 5 of the ECIS.
2. Documents that proof the relationship, the dependency and the EEA national exercising treaty rights and being resident in the UK.
